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from London Marylebone to Rhosneigr start from as little as £18.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from London Marylebone to Rhosneigr start from £88.70 one way, or £102.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from London Marylebone to Rhosneigr are available for £124.20 one way, or £212.40 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

London Marylebone Station is equipped with a range of facilities designed to ensure a convenient and accessible experience for all travelers. There is a well-staffed ticket office, open from early morning to late at night, along with ticket machines accessible to those with disabilities. You can rest easy knowing that step-free access is available throughout the station, making it accessible for everyone. Additionally, induction loops are in place for those with hearing impairments.

Although there aren’t waiting rooms, the station does provide seating areas. You will also find public toilets, accessible toilets, and baby changing facilities within the station, which are essential for any long-distance journey. If you're looking for a place to grab a bite or a coffee, there are various food outlets and coffee shops. The station even hosts a small selection of shops, including a newsagent, a flower stall, and a shoe repairer among others. Wi-Fi connectivity is readily available, ensuring you remain connected while on the move.

Onward Travel from London Marylebone

At London Marylebone Station, you have access to a multitude of onward travel options. The taxi rank right outside the station provides easy connections, with buses also readily available nearby. Those heading into the heart of London can make use of the Marylebone Underground station, which is on the Bakerloo Line. A short walk will take you to Baker Street station, where you can board Circle, Hammersmith and City, Jubilee, and Metropolitan Line services.

For those keen on cycling, you'll be pleased to find a Santander Cycles docking station located conveniently at Boston Place, right at the side of Marylebone Station. A good amount of secure bicycle storage is also offered for season ticket holders, perfect for those integrating cycling into their daily commute.

Rhosneigr Station Facilities

If you are planning a trip to this idyllic locale, it's essential to know what to expect upon arrival at Rhosneigr train station. While modest in structure, the station lacks a ticket office and ticket machines. That makes it crucial to purchase and print your tickets in advance or opt for mobile ticketing for a seamless experience. The station does feature an induction loop, ensuring services are accessible to those with hearing aids.

Despite its rustic appeal, the station offers step-free access to both platforms via narrow lanes from Station Road, distinguishing it as a Category B3 station. Those traversing between platforms should be mindful, as there’s no pavement beneath the railway bridge. The station lacks some modern amenities, such as accessible toilets and staffed help points. Travelers needing assistance can pre-arrange support via Passenger Assist. Onward Journeys and Transport Links

For those continuing their journey, Rhosneigr provides convenient onward travel options. Although buses and rail replacement services are located closely to the station, no cycle hire facilities are readily available. Plan to catch a bus near the access ramp to platform 2 or locate the rail replacement stop on the main road.
